The vast majority of nations have something called "Cultural Protocols", a bill which reflects their unique culture, history and heritage and protects the nation from future players arriving and arbitrarily deciding to shit all over that history by making the place, say, Dutch, or Chinese, or what-have-you. Unfortunately, it seems Jelbania has been the victim of such shenanigans many times over before the Cultural Protocols were a thing, so it can get pretty confusing figuring out what kind of culture we're actually supposed to have. But I think it would be very desirable for us to write a cultural protocol, to avoid that happening in the future.

I just spend a long (long, LONG) time digging through the bill history of Jelbania, and I've made something of a timeline of the cultural history here.

~2136, Jelbania is created by the game-devs. It's a generic republic and devoid of any cultural theme, like every other newly created nation.

-2283,
Jelbania gets her first taste of cultural identity. The Jelbic culture is designed, taking a vaguely steppe-person or central asian theme, and using a conlang with entirely too many consonants and not enough vowels. Jelbic culture is initially very popular, with related ethnic groups springing up in Barmenia, Vanuku, Pontesi and Dissuwa (a Deltarian minority)

So here we enter what the JKK wish to discus, the status of the two languages that have been used within our nation to name its official institutions since 2283.

It is our belief that the following explain current circumstances as to the languages associated with our nation.

Jelb�k � Historical records ascertain that this language has been in the region since AD 400 (http://particracy.wikia.com/wiki/Terran ... ies#Jelbic ) (http://particracy.wikia.com/wiki/Jelb%C3%A9k ), and is part of a group of languages that have been spoken in the region, initially covering fair chunk of our continent (Majatra), but now reduced to Pontesi and Jelbania.

French � On the other hand French, ethnicity and language (http://particracy.wikia.com/wiki/French_%28ethnicity%29 ) have no real heritage in either Jelbania, or our continent Majatra. In fact French speaking nations are primarily located in southern Seleya (http://80.237.164.51/particracy/main/vi ... eatyid=481 the red blob in the bottom right hand corner of the map ). Indeed of the five nations on Terra that have French names, Jelbania is the only one located outside of Seleya, indeed the only one located outside of southern Seleya.

Conclusion � Therefore it can be seen that French cannot be native to Jelbania. The history on the wikia points to the conclusion that French is native to southern Seleya, whereas proto-Jelbic is native to northwestern Majatra. Therefore Jelb�k must be considered as the ancestral language of the nation, and the people of this nation.

Proposal � However we recognise that French is a part of our history and culture, and has a special place in the nation, therefore we propose the following.

Jelb�k is the language, or rather ancestral language of most Jelbanians. However today it is often seen as a sign of backwardness, and is largely spoken in rural areas and amongst the lower orders of society. It maintains a toehold in high culture, but has lost its official status within the nation. On the other hand there has been a shift amongst the cultural, political and economic elite�s of the nation towards the use of the French language, something that was evident a long time ago (say when the CCU was first founded), and became an established fact in the 2390�s, and continues today. Thus the French language and culture is an important part of the ruling class of our society, but note they are not of French ethnicity, as people of such ethnicity dwell in southern Seleya, but never in Majatra.

Ooc: Basically think of Lebanon today, where French became the preferred language of the Christian elites in that nation, and was used as the official language, whilst Arabic remained largely spoken amongst the rest of the population. Also look at Latin in medieval Europe, weher it was the language of the elites, but not of the poor, nor was it the ancestral language of most Europeans.
